Cooking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and grease a 12-cup muffin tin.
- In a large skillet, heat oil over medium heat. Add ground turkey and cook until browned, about 6-8 minutes. Add onions, bell peppers, and jalapeño, sautéing until softened, about 3-4 minutes. Stir in chili powder and cumin for 1 minute.
- In a mixing bowl, crack the eggs and whisk with salt and pepper until frothy.
- Fold the turkey-vegetable mixture into the whisked eggs, then mix in shredded cheese and chopped cilantro.
- Pour the egg and turkey mixture into muffin cups, filling them about three-quarters full. Place the muffin tin on a baking sheet.
- Bake for 18-22 minutes, until tops are lightly golden and a toothpick inserted comes out clean.
- Cool for a few minutes, run a knife around edges, and serve warm with your favorite garnishes.
